#!/bin/bash
# SPDX-License-Identifier: BSD-3-Clause
SCRIPT_PATH="$( cd -- "$(dirname "$0")" >/dev/null 2>&1 ; pwd -P )"
FLAT_BUILD=${SCRIPT_PATH}/data
REP_ROOT=${SCRIPT_PATH}/..
QDL=${REP_ROOT}/qdl
ANY_FAIL=0
cd $FLAT_BUILD
die() { echo "FAIL: $*" >&2; exit 1; }
need_cmd() { command -v "$1" >/dev/null 2>&1 || die "Missing required command: $1"; }
between_markers() {
local haystack="$1" start="$2" end="$3"
awk -v s="$start" -v e="$end" '
$0 ~ s {inside=1; next}
$0 ~ e {inside=0}
inside {print}
' <<<"$haystack" | sed -e 's/[[:space:]]\+$//' -e '/^[[:space:]]*$/d'
}
assert_programmer() {
local programmer="$1"; shift
local expected_exit_code=$1; shift
local expected="$(printf '%s\n' "$@")"
out="$(${QDL} --dry-run --debug "$programmer" rawprogram0.xml 2>&1)"
if (( $? != expected_exit_code )); then
printf "%-60s FAIL\n" "$programmer"
echo "Got:"
echo "$out"
ANY_FAIL=1
return
fi
block="$(between_markers "$out" "Sahara images:" "waiting for")"
if [[ "$block" == "$expected" ]]; then
printf "%-60s OK\n" "$programmer"
else
printf "%-60s FAIL\n" "$programmer"
echo "Expected:"
echo "$expected"
echo "Got:"
#echo "$out"
echo "$block"
ANY_FAIL=1
fi
}
mk_fixture_sahara() {
local out="$1"; shift
local pair id path
{
echo '<?xml version="1.0" ?>'
echo '<sahara_config>'
echo $'\t<images>'
for pair in "$@"; do
id="${pair%%:*}"
path="${pair#*:}"
printf $'\t\t<image image_id="%s" image_path="%s" />\n' "$id" "$path"
done
echo $'\t</images>'
echo '</sahara_config>'
} > "$out"
}
mk_fixture_cpio() {
local out="$1"; shift
local pair id file tmpdir
tmpdir="$(mktemp -d)"
trap 'rm -rf "$tmpdir"' RETURN
for pair in "$@"; do
id="${pair%%:*}"
file="${pair#*:}"
# Create a symlink with the desired name inside a temp dir
ln -s "../$file" "$tmpdir/$id:$file" 2> /dev/null || {
echo "Unable to create cpio archive: can't create '$id:$file'"
return
}
done
(
cd "$tmpdir"
printf '%s\n' * | cpio -o -H newc 2> /dev/null
) > "$out"
}
need_cmd awk
need_cmd sed
need_cmd cpio
#
# Create test content
#
cp prog_firehose_ddr.elf prog_A.elf
cp prog_firehose_ddr.elf prog_B.elf
cp prog_firehose_ddr.elf prog_C.elf
cp prog_firehose_ddr.elf c:\\prog_D.elf
cp prog_firehose_ddr.elf 13prog_A.elf
cp prog_firehose_ddr.elf 13a:14prog_A.elf || true
mk_fixture_sahara "sahara-prog_A-prog_B.xml" "13:prog_A.elf" "14:prog_B.elf"
mk_fixture_sahara "sahara-invalid-id.xml" "999:prog_A.elf"
mk_fixture_sahara "sahara-windows.xml" "13:c:\\prog_D.elf"
mk_fixture_sahara "sahara-non-exist.xml" "999:nonexisting-programmer.elf"
mk_fixture_sahara "sahara-empty-path.xml" "13:"
mk_fixture_sahara "sahara-absolute-path.xml" "13:$(readlink -f prog_A.elf)"
mk_fixture_cpio "sahara-prog_A-prog_B.cpio" "13:prog_A.elf" "14:prog_B.elf"
mk_fixture_cpio "sahara-invalid-id.cpio" "999:prog_A.elf"
#
# Test single file, no ids
#
assert_programmer "prog_A.elf" 0 " 13: prog_A.elf"
assert_programmer "c:\\prog_D.elf" 0 " 13: c:\\prog_D.elf"
#
# Test programmers specified with ID on command line
#
assert_programmer "13:c:\\prog_D.elf" 0 " 13: c:\\prog_D.elf"
assert_programmer "13:prog_A.elf" 0 " 13: prog_A.elf"
assert_programmer "13:prog_A.elf,14:prog_B.elf" 0 \
" 13: prog_A.elf" \
" 14: prog_B.elf"
assert_programmer "13:prog_A.elf,14:prog_B.elf,15:prog_C.elf" 0 \
" 13: prog_A.elf" \
" 14: prog_B.elf" \
" 15: prog_C.elf"
assert_programmer "13prog_A.elf" 0 " 13: 13prog_A.elf"
if [ -z "$MSYSTEM" ]; then
assert_programmer "13a:14prog_A.elf" 0 " 13: 13a:14prog_A.elf"
else
printf "%-60s SKIP\n" "13a:14prog_A.elf"
fi
#
# Test Sahara device programmer XML handling
#
assert_programmer "sahara-prog_A-prog_B.xml" 0 \
" 13: ./prog_A.elf" \
" 14: ./prog_B.elf"
if [ -n "$MSYSTEM" ]; then
assert_programmer "sahara-windows.xml" 0 \
" 13: c:\\prog_D.elf"
else
printf "%-60s SKIP\n" "sahara-windows.xml"
fi
assert_programmer "sahara-invalid-id.xml" 1 ""
assert_programmer "sahara-non-exist.xml" 1 ""
assert_programmer "sahara-empty-path.xml" 1 ""
#
# Test Sahara Archives
#
if [ -f "sahara-prog_A-prog_B.cpio" ]; then
assert_programmer "sahara-prog_A-prog_B.cpio" 0 \
" 13: prog_A.elf" \
" 14: prog_B.elf"
else
printf "%-60s SKIP\n" "sahara-prog_A-prog_B.cpio"
fi
if [ -f "sahara-invalid-id.cpio" ]; then
assert_programmer "sahara-invalid-id.cpio" 1 ""
else
printf "%-60s SKIP\n" "sahara-invalid-id.cpio"
fi
#
# Clean up
#
rm -f 13a:prog_A.elf \
13prog_A.elf \
c:\\prog_D.elf \
prog_A.elf \
prog_B.elf \
prog_C.elf \
sahara-absolute-path.xml \
sahara-empty-path.xml \
sahara-invalid-id.cpio \
sahara-invalid-id.xml \
sahara-non-exist.xml \
sahara-prog_A-prog_B.cpio \
sahara-prog_A-prog_B.xml \
sahara-windows.xml
exit $ANY_FAIL
